I'm invoking method annotated with @Remove

@Remove

public void remove() {

...

On invocation inside active transaction I'm getting following error :

Caused by: java.lang.IllegalStateException: ARJUNA016082: Synchronizations are not allowed! Transaction status isActionStatus.RUNNING

EJB Spec paragraphe 4.6.4 states:
If a session bean instance is participating in a transaction, it is an error for a client to invoke the remove method on the session object’s home or component interface object. The container must detect such an attempt and throw the javax.ejb.RemoveException to the client. The container should not mark the client’s transaction for rollback, thus allowing the client to recover. Note that this restriction only applies to the remove method on the session object’s home or component interface, not to the invocation of @Remove methods.
